def should_mqtt_motion(self, camera, motion_boxes):
# publish if motion is currently being detected
if motion_boxes:
self.client.publish(
f"{self.topic_prefix}/{camera}/motion/detected",
True,
retain=False,
)
self.last_motion_updates[camera] = int(time.time())
elif not motion_boxes and self.last_motion_updates.get(camera, 0) != 0:
mqtt_delay = self.config.cameras[camera].motion.mqtt_off_delay
now = int(time.time())
# If no motion, make sure the off_delay has passed
if now - self.last_motion >= mqtt_delay:
self.client.publish(
f"{self.topic_prefix}/{camera}/motion/detected",
False,
retain=False,
)
# reset the last_motion so redundant `off` commands aren't sent
self.last_motion_updates[camera] = 0
